完善资料让更多小伙伴认识你,还能领取20积分哦, 立即完善>
一、设计目的 1.了解并行口输入/输出方式的工作原理及其使用方法。 2.掌握80C51单片机扩展74LS244输入数据及扩展74LS273输出数据的方法 二、设计要求 1.利用单片机设计一个简单的以8位逻辑电平开关K0~K7作为8位密码输入,设两路密码锁,第一路密码为10101010,第二路密码为11110000。 2.以8个发光二极管作为输出,当输入的密码与第一路密码相同时,第一个发光二极管点亮。当输入的密码与第二路密码相同时,第二个发光二极管点亮。如果输入的密码与两路密码都不同,则8个发光二极管全部点亮。 3.必须先输入第一路密码,然后输入第二路密码才能使第二个发光二极管点亮。 画完电路图后,加入hex程序不能实现对应的功能 DATA_IN EQU 8000H DATA_OUT EQU 8100H ORG 0100H MOV A,#0FFH MOV DPTR,#DATA_OUT MOVX @DPTR,A LOOP: MOV DPTR,#DATA_IN MOVX A,@DPTR CJNE A,#10101010B,LOOP1 MOV DPTR,#DATA_OUT MOV A,#0FEH MOV B,A MOVX @DPTR,A LOOP1: CJNE A,#11110000B,LOOP MOV A,B CJNE A,#0FEH,LOOP MOV DPTR,#DATA_OUT MOV A,#0FDH ANL A,B MOVX @DPTR,A SJMP LOOP END 不知道哪里错了,需要大佬帮忙看看
|
|
相关推荐 |
|
你正在撰写答案
如果你是对答案或其他答案精选点评或询问,请使用“评论”功能。
5872 浏览 3 评论
7143 浏览 1 评论
7388 浏览 0 评论
Protues中自己封装的芯片元件无Program File、Clock Frequency选项怎么解决,求求大神了!
9179 浏览 1 评论
基于51单片机的车辆倒车雷达报警系统,HC-SR04超声波测距,全套资料
1265 浏览 0 评论
小黑屋| 手机版| Archiver| 电子发烧友 ( 湘ICP备2023018690号 )
GMT+8, 2024-12-18 21:37 , Processed in 0.587613 second(s), Total 76, Slave 57 queries .
Powered by 电子发烧友网
© 2015 bbs.elecfans.com
关注我们的微信
下载发烧友APP
电子发烧友观察
版权所有 © 湖南华秋数字科技有限公司
电子发烧友 (电路图) 湘公网安备 43011202000918 号 电信与信息服务业务经营许可证:合字B2-20210191 工商网监 湘ICP备2023018690号